WHAT:  JOURNEYS – A choir concert presented by Out in Harmony – Vancouver’s favorite Gay, Bi, Trans, Queer, Lesbian, and Friends Community Choir.
There will be raffle prizes drawn during the concert and a reception afterwards.

WHEN: 7:30 pm Saturday, June 29, 2019. Doors open at 7:00 pm.

WHERE: Unitarian Church of Vancouver, 949 West 49th Ave (corner of 49th & Oak).
The nearest Skytrain Station is Langara-49th Station, and the #17(Oak Street) and #49 (49th Ave) buses stop nearby.

TICKETS: Admission price $20 or pay what you can; no one turned away for lack of funds.
Tickets may be purchased via cash or cheque from choir members or at the door, or by using your credit card at https://oih-journeys.eventbrite.com/  (processing fee applies).

ACCESSIBILITY:  The venue is wheelchair accessible.  The nearest Skytrain Station is Langara-49th Station, and the #17 (Oak Street) and #49 (49th Ave) buses stop nearby.   In keeping with our commitment to accessibility, this will be a scent-reduced event; please abstain from wearing perfumes or scents so that those with allergies and sensitivities are able to come and enjoy the concert.  No-one turned away for lack of funds.
